tboy81:

I intend to write my GRE/TOEFL in October.

I was just wondering, even if someone pays for you in the US, won't the Testing center stil collect some form of money for writing the exam in their centre?






No, the center wont collect any money from you for writing the exam there. The funny thing is that I didnt even write my exams at the centered I registered. I wrote the TOEFL at Yaba and the GRE at Ikeja.

My TOEFL exam was postponed 3 times. Each time, about 2 or 3 weeks. So I got to write it after about 10weeks I registered.
Why is was postponed was because the centers I was told to write the exam didnt have a good Internet connection on the day of the exam. And because TOEFL is iBT, the results and questions are been downloaded and submitted real time. Without a good connection, if you get disconnected, thats the end of the exam.

Which is why I suggested First Logic because they have good Internet connection and the chances of your exams being postponed by this issue will be low.

I didn't get GRE exam date until about 5 weeks after I registered though it wasn't postponed unlike the TOEFL.

If you plan to write either exams, I suggest you register like 10 weeks before your desired exam date.

kev-d:

@bigboyslim and sayhi2ay, I was asked by the school im applying to to forward my financial statement to prepare an i-20 for visa preparations., please i have 2 questions. 1- should the financial statement be in dollars or in our local currency?
2- what is the minimum amt that should be in my account so as not to hurt my chances of getting admission and who should own the account?Thanks
1. If the statement is in Naira, they know how to do the conversion. Dont worry about that.

2. The balance in the account I used was 30000Naira or something similar. What they actually look at is the total amount debited and credited to the account, not the current balance. So that is the amount that would be printed on your I-20. Well, it could be different from other schools.
But am not saying I used the same statement at the embassy. I used that account cos I was posting it and dont know what could have happened along its way, lol,
At the consulate, they check the BALANCE.

I think its better your parents be your sponsor.

kev-d:

@sayhi2ay and bigboyslim.Thank you very much for your assistance you guys are Godsent. i still have some questions,
1-I made my application online and i intend to pay the application fee next week, will it hinder my application?
2- How should i send my Transcript currently in my possesion to the School being that they do not accept transcripts directly from students?
3- Can i send certified photocopies of my transcript?
4- I intend to write GRE come november this year will it hinder my plans for the fall of next year?

1. Once the school get the application fee, they will begin the admission process. Without this fee, they wont touch your application.

2. It doesnt matter if you send the transcript yourself or through your school, what matters is that the transcript is sealed and doesnt look tampered with. Also, there should be a letter in the envelope saying that you asked that your transcript be sent to them.(very very important). I got my transcript from my school, and FedEx it myself, if the school had sent it for me, God knows when they will get it, that is if they even get it at all.

3. Ask the school if they will accept. I strongly doubt that though.

4. No it wont. The result expires after 5 years I think. Why wait till next Fall anyways?
